Output 33f613c14bcbbd718a96e8af71db1fa379e22a3a5d0aa76b458b27e062f1223f:6

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 53ae329d4ed4c6dcf87fd144e25db7924620c61680d95863b2fcf4fcac4c0843
address
bc1p2whr982w6nrde7rl69zwyhdhjfrzp3sksrv4scajln60etzvppps2tp0pa
transaction
33f613c14bcbbd718a96e8af71db1fa379e22a3a5d0aa76b458b27e062f1223f
spent
true